If you do not wish to do so, delete thisexception statement from your version. */package javax.swing.text;import java.awt.Graphics;import java.awt.Rectangle;import java.awt.Shape;import javax.swing.Icon;import javax.swing.JTextPane;import javax.swing.SwingConstants;/** * A View that can render an icon. This view is created by the * {@link StyledEditorKit}'s view factory for all elements that have name * {@link StyleConstants#IconElementName}. This is usually created by * inserting an icon into <code>JTextPane</code> using * {@link JTextPane#insertIcon(Icon)} * * The icon is determined using the attribute * {@link StyleConstants#IconAttribute}, which's value must be an {@link Icon}. * * @author Roman Kennke (kennke@aicas.com) */public class IconView  extends View{  /**   * Creates a new <code>IconView</code> for the given <code>Element</code>.   *   * @param element the element that is rendered by this IconView   */  public IconView(Element element)  {    super(element);  }  /**   * Renders the <code>Element</code> that is associated with this   * <code>View</code>.   *   * @param g the <code>Graphics</code> context to render to   * @param a the allocated region for the <code>Element</code>   */  public void paint(Graphics g, Shape a)  {    Icon icon = StyleConstants.getIcon(getElement().getAttributes());    Rectangle b = a.getBounds();    icon.paintIcon(getContainer(), g, b.x, b.y);  }  /**   * Returns the preferred span of the content managed by this   * <code>View</code> along the specified <code>axis</code>.   *   * @param axis the axis   *   * @return the preferred span of this <code>View</code>.   */  public float getPreferredSpan(int axis)  {    Icon icon = StyleConstants.getIcon(getElement().getAttributes());    float span;    if (axis == X_AXIS)      span = icon.getIconWidth();    else if (axis == Y_AXIS)      span = icon.getIconHeight();    else      throw new IllegalArgumentException();    return span;  }  /**   * Maps a position in the document into the coordinate space of the View.   * The output rectangle usually reflects the font height but has a width   * of zero.   *   * @param pos the position of the character in the model   * @param a the area that is occupied by the view   * @param b either {@link Position.Bias#Forward} or   *        {@link Position.Bias#Backward} depending on the preferred   *        direction bias. If <code>null</code> this defaults to   *        <code>Position.Bias.Forward</code>   *   * @return a rectangle that gives the location of the document position   *         inside the view coordinate space   *   * @throws BadLocationException if <code>pos</code> is invalid   * @throws IllegalArgumentException if b is not one of the above listed   *         valid values   */  public Shape modelToView(int pos, Shape a, Position.Bias b)    throws BadLocationException  {    Element el = getElement();    if (pos < el.getStartOffset() || pos >= el.getEndOffset())      throw new BadLocationException("Illegal offset for this view", pos);    Rectangle r = a.getBounds();    Icon icon = StyleConstants.getIcon(el.getAttributes());    return new Rectangle(r.x, r.y, icon.getIconWidth(), icon.getIconHeight());  }  /**   * Maps coordinates from the <code>View</code>'s space into a position   * in the document model.   *   * @param x the x coordinate in the view space   * @param y the y coordinate in the view space   * @param a the allocation of this <code>View</code>   * @param b the bias to use   *   * @return the position in the document that corresponds to the screen   *         coordinates <code>x, y</code>   */  public int viewToModel(float x, float y, Shape a, Position.Bias[] b)  {    // The element should only have one character position and it is clear    // that this position is the position that best matches the given screen    // coordinates, simply because this view has only this one position.    Element el = getElement();    return el.getStartOffset();  }  /**   * Returns the document position that is (visually) nearest to the given   * document position <code>pos</code> in the given direction <code>d</code>.   *   * @param c the text component   * @param pos the document position   * @param b the bias for <code>pos</code>   * @param d the direction, must be either {@link SwingConstants#NORTH},   *        {@link SwingConstants#SOUTH}, {@link SwingConstants#WEST} or   *        {@link SwingConstants#EAST}   * @param biasRet an array of {@link Position.Bias} that can hold at least   *        one element, which is filled with the bias of the return position   *        on method exit   *   * @return the document position that is (visually) nearest to the given   *         document position <code>pos</code> in the given direction   *         <code>d</code>   *   * @throws BadLocationException if <code>pos</code> is not a valid offset in   *         the document model   */  public int getNextVisualPositionFrom(JTextComponent c, int pos,                                       Position.Bias b, int d,                                       Position.Bias[] biasRet)    throws BadLocationException  {    // TODO: Implement this properly.    throw new AssertionError("Not implemented yet.");  }}
